The procedure of submitting a mesothelioma lawsuit can be complicated, however it normally follows these actions:
Consultation with an Attorney: Finding an attorney with experience in mesothelioma cases is important. They can help assess your scenario and discuss your alternatives.
Investigation and Evidence Collection: Your lawyer will gather proof, consisting of medical records, work history, and documentation of asbestos exposure, to build your case.
Filing the Complaint: Once enough proof is gathered, the attorney will submit a problem in court, officially starting the lawsuit against the accountable celebrations.
Discovery Phase: Both celebrations exchange proof and info associated to the case. This stage might also include depositions, where witnesses supply sworn statement.
Settlement: Many mesothelioma cases are settled out of court. Your attorney will work out in your place for a fair payment plan.
Trial: If an arrangement can not be reached, the case will go to trial. Here, a judge or jury will figure out the outcome.
Decision and Appeal: If the court guidelines in your favor, you may get compensation. Nevertheless, the offender can appeal the choice.

Compensation amounts for mesothelioma cases can differ considerably based on a number of aspects, including:
Severity of Illness: The stage of mesothelioma can influence the payment quantity. Advanced stages might yield higher settlement.
Exposure History: The amount of time and degree of exposure to asbestos can likewise affect the claim.
Economic Losses: This consists of medical bills, lost income, and future costs connected to treatment and care.
Non-Economic Damages: Victims can likewise look for payment for discomfort and suffering, psychological distress, and loss of pleasure of life.

What is the statute of limitations for filing a mesothelioma lawsuit?
The statute of constraints differs by state but typically varies from one to three years after medical diagnosis or death.
Can I file a lawsuit if I was exposed to asbestos years ago?
Yes, many individuals can still file a lawsuit even if the direct exposure took place decades earlier, as long as they satisfy the statute of limitations requirements.
How long does the lawsuit process take?
The timeline can differ substantially depending upon case intricacy and whether it goes to trial. Most cases can take a number of months to a few years.
What if I can't pay for an attorney?
Lots of mesothelioma lawyers work on a contingency cost basis, indicating you only pay if you win your case.
What if the responsible business is insolvent?
If the accountable company has declared insolvency, you may still be entitled to payment through asbestos trust funds.
